Understanding the Danish Driver's License System
The Danish motorist's license (Få Et Krav Til Dansk Kørekort I Danmark (https://cameradb.review/wiki/Why_All_The_Fuss_Over_Danish_Drivers_License_Benefits)) is governed by rigorous regulations designed to guarantee roadway safety. A driver's license is not simply a permit to drive; it represents a commitment to safe driving practices. In Denmark, there are several categories of licenses, depending upon the kind of vehicle an individual wishes to drive:
| License Category | Car Type |
|---|---|
| Category A1 | Motorcycles approximately 125cc |
| Category A | Motorcycles over 125cc |
| Classification B | Cars (and light vans approximately 3,500 kg) |
| Category C | Heavy vehicles (trucks) |
| Category D | Buses |
| Category E | Trailers and semi-trailers |
This article will mostly focus on obtaining a Category B license, which is the most typically looked for license for individual usage.
Eligibility Requirements
Before requesting a motorist's license in Denmark, it's essential to guarantee that you fulfill the list below requirements:
- Age: You need to be at least 17 years old to apply for a driving test for a Category B license.
- Residency: You should be a citizen of Denmark or have a legal residency status to request a Danish driver's license.
- Health Declaration: A finished health declaration is required. In many cases, a medical checkup might be required.
- Proficiency in Danish: While not compulsory, it is a good idea to comprehend Danish, as the lessons and tests are generally performed in the regional language.
Step-by-Step Guide to Applying for a Danish Driver's License
1. Enlist in a Driving School
The very first action towards getting a chauffeur's license is to enroll in an authorized driving school. Choose a school that is well-reviewed and uses courses in English if you are not proficient in Danish. Here is a list of factors to consider when selecting a driving school:
- Check the school's accreditation.
- Search for reviews by previous students.
- Ask about the instructors' qualifications and experience.
- Comprehend the course duration and material.
2. Complete the Required Theory and Practical Lessons
When enrolled, you will need to complete the theoretical lessons, Dansk id-Kort online which cover crucial subjects such as traffic rules, roadway indications, and ansøG Om dansk Kørekort safe driving practices. The normal structure includes:
Theory Courses: These courses often culminate in a theoretical test. It is vital to study vigilantly, making use of offered resources, including books and online materials.
Practical Driving Lessons: You must finish a designated number of practical driving lessons with a certified instructor. The number of lessons might differ based on specific ability levels.
3. Pass the Theoretical Test
After completing the necessary theory lessons, you will take a written or digital theory test. This test assesses your understanding of traffic laws and safe driving practices. Here's what to expect:
- Multiple-choice concerns.
- A time limitation (generally 45-60 minutes).
- A passing rating, typically around 80%.
4. Total the Practical Driving Test
Upon passing the theoretical test, you can arrange your practical driving test. This test will evaluate your driving abilities in real-life road conditions. Keep the following tips in mind:
- Practice thoroughly with your trainer.
- Discover the test routes, which might help in preparation.
- Stay calm and focused throughout the test.
5. Obtain a Health Certificate
Before your last application, guarantee that you have a health certificate. This might have been acquired throughout your preliminary application for a driving school, but if not, you might require to speak with a medical professional who can examine your physical fitness to drive and sign a health declaration.
6. Request Your Driver's License
Once you have actually passed both the theoretical and dry runs and gathered all required documents, you can make an application for your Danish motorist's license at the regional town (kommune). Required files usually include:
- Completed application kind.
- Theory test certificate.
- Practical driving test certificate.
- Health statement.
- A legitimate type of recognition (passport or nationwide Dansk Id Med Bitcoin).
- Passport-sized photographs.
7. Pay the Fees
There are involved costs with the application process, which may consist of:
- Driving school charges (theoretical and useful).
- Test costs for the theory and useful tests.
- License issuance fees.
Being gotten ready for these costs will decrease surprises along the method.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. The length of time does it require to get a Danish chauffeur's license?
The time it requires to obtain a Danish motorist's license can vary considerably based on individual availability, study routines, and how quickly one finds out to drive. On average, expect the process to take several months.
2. Do I need to take lessons if I already have a foreign motorist's license?
If you hold a legitimate driver's license from another EU/EEA country, you might be able to drive in Denmark without further tests. However, it's suggested to check if you need to exchange your license for a Danish one.
3. What occurs if I fail the theoretical or dry run?
If you fail either test, you can retake them. However, you may require to wait a specific duration before retaking the dry run, which can differ by municipality.
4. Can I drive while my application is being processed?
No, you need to hold a legitimate driver's license to drive legally in Denmark. Driving without a license might have legal effects.
5. Exist any exceptions to the health declaration requirement?
In some cases, if you have specific medical conditions, you may need an in-depth evaluation. It's suggested to inquire at your driving school or the local authorities for specific guidance.
